Step-by-Step: Downloading via the Web Interface

This method is straightforward, like plucking a ripe fruit from a tree, and it’s ideal for quick grabs without installing extra tools. Let’s break it down:

  • Locate your repository: Type the repo’s name in the search bar. For instance, if you’re after the “freeCodeCamp” project, search for that and click on it. You’ll land on a page that feels like a digital blueprint, with files listed neatly.
  • Navigate to the file or folder: Click through directories if needed. Imagine you’re exploring a file cabinet; open folders to find what you seek. If it’s a single file, like a Python script, just click on it to view the contents.
  • Hit the download button: On the file’s page, spot the green “Code” button at the top. Click it, then select “Download ZIP” for the entire repository. This compresses everything into a handy file, perfect for beginners. I’ve used this for years when I need something fast, like importing a CSS framework into a web project.
  • Extract and organize: Once downloaded, unzip the file using your computer’s native tools. On Windows, right-click and choose “Extract All”; on a Mac, double-click it. Then, sort the files into your project folder—think of it as tidying up after a successful hunt.

This approach works wonders for small-scale needs, but it can get clunky with large repos. In one case, I downloaded a 500MB dataset this way, and it took ages, teaching me the value of patience in tech pursuits.

Diving Deeper: Using Git for More Control

If web downloads feel too basic, like using a spoon when you need a shovel, Git is your next level. This command-line tool lets you clone repositories directly, keeping everything version-controlled and up-to-date. It’s like having a direct line to the source, and once you master it, you’ll wonder how you ever managed without.

To get started, install Git from git-scm.com. The process is simple: download the installer, follow the prompts, and verify with a command like git --version in your terminal. Here’s where the magic happens:

  • Open your terminal or command prompt: On Windows, search for “Command Prompt”; on Mac or Linux, use Terminal. It’s your gateway to a more powerful world, where commands flow like a river carving through code.
  • Navigate to your desired directory: Use cd path/to/folder to get where you want. For example, if you’re working on a desktop project, type cd Documents/Projects. This step is crucial—it’s like setting the stage before a performance.
  • Clone the repository: Enter git clone https://github.com/username/repo-name.git. Replace the URL with the one from GitHub; you can find it by clicking the green “Code” button and copying the HTTPS link. For a unique example, try cloning “torvalds/linux,” the kernel that powers your operating system—it’s a beast at over 20GB, so choose wisely to avoid overwhelming your storage.
  • Handle authentication if needed: Some repos require permissions. If you’re dealing with private ones, use git clone https://username:token@github.com/username/repo-name.git, swapping in your personal access token from GitHub settings. I once forgot this and spent an hour troubleshooting—don’t let that be you.
  • Update and explore: After cloning, run git pull to fetch the latest changes. It’s like checking for mail; you never know what gems might arrive.

Using Git feels exhilarating at first, with that rush of seeing code sync seamlessly, but it can frustrate when errors pop up, like when a merge conflict halts your progress. Still, it’s a skill that pays off, as in my own projects where cloning saved hours of manual downloads.

Practical Tips to Avoid Common Pitfalls

From my journeys through GitHub’s labyrinth, here are tips that cut through the noise. First, always check file sizes before downloading—nothing stings like tying up your bandwidth for a massive archive you didn’t need. Use browser extensions like “GitZip” to download specific folders, which is a game-changer for targeted grabs.

Watch for licensing; not every repo is free to use commercially, so read the fine print—it’s like scanning a map for hidden traps. If you’re on a slow connection, opt for GitHub’s release assets, which are pre-packaged and often lighter. And remember, if Git commands feel intimidating, tools like GitHub Desktop provide a graphical interface that’s as smooth as driving on a well-paved road.
